I may be having issues with mine, haven't had the time to test it yet. Idle is all over, yet timing is perfect, new plugs new wires and no vacuum leaks. It'll go up, stick, then come down too far and nearly kill it, if i tap the gas it sticks then will drop too far, then over correct. It does this when warm and when cold. Motor runs strong in all other aspects. Back when I had a neon (the only other computer controlled car I have owned) it's IAC went bad and was doing the exact same things. I was told I could have possibly saved it by cleaning it up.

So, my question is, what is the best way to clean the dang thing. There was some gunk in my throttle body when I bought the car so its not a far reach to think the ICV would be gunked up also. I don't want to pull it off, then clean it with something and have whatever I used kill it.

Also, if it does need replaced, what all other toyota cars have the same part in them? I've found out pretty fast that you put "Supra" in front of the part the damn auto places tack on an extra 50 bucks.

Anyway, not meaning to threadjack, I believe this is all on topic, and I didn't want to make another post when it could all be answered here.
